How to Make Japanese Style Steak with Wasabi

With father's day coming up, steak is often on the menu. But you know what's better than steak? A steak cooked with Japanese flavours and plenty of delicious wasabi. Steak goes magnificently with wasabi!

This time we're cooking the meat with a teriyaki sauce - you can choose to cook on a griddle pan, or even on a BBQ if the weather is good this weekend!

You Will Need

Teriyaki Sauce

  • 5 Tbsp Soy Sauce
  • 5 Tbsp Sugar
  • 50ml Water
  • 2 Tbsp Mirin
  • 2 Tsp Ginger Paste
  • 1 Tsp Garlic Paste
  • 1 Tsp Chilli Paste
  • 2 Tsp Corn Flour
  • 1 Tsp Honey

And the rest!

  • 2 Lbs Flank Steak
  • Salt and pepper
  • Sesame Seeds
  • 1-2 Tsp Wasabi

Method

  •  To make a teriyaki glaze, start by adding all the ingredients to a saucepan apart from the corn flour and the honey. Mix well on a low simmer, then add in the corn flour. Simmer further then stir in the honey as the sauce thickens.
  • Season your steak on both sides and heat the bbq grill to the white hot coals stage. Turn regularly and cook for about 7-10 minutes depending on your preference.
  • Serve the steak hot with the wasabi on the side, and glaze the steak with the sauce. You can serve with new potatoes if you like, or a fresh cold noodle salad!
